Is Hungry Burrito clean?
New York currently lists Hungry Burrito as grade pending, following an inspection on March 27, 2023 that scored 15 points. The city has not posted a letter yet, and it will not until a re-inspection settles it.
What did inspectors find at Hungry Burrito?
These are the violations recorded at the most recent inspection on March 27, 2023, in plain English, with the city's own wording underneath.
- π½οΈfood left out / unprotectedcriticalFood, supplies, or equipment not protected from potential source of contamination during storage, preparation, transportation, display, service or from customerβs refillable, reusable container. Condiments not in single-service containers or dispensed directly by the vendor.
- πno certified food supervisor on dutycriticalFood Protection Certificate (FPC) not held by manager or supervisor of food operations.

How New York grades restaurants
New York City health inspectors score violations in points, and lower is better: 0β13 points earns an A, 14β27 a B, and 28 or more a C. Every restaurant is inspected at least once a year, and the letter has to be posted in the window. A restaurant that scores 14 or more on the first inspection of a cycle does not get a letter right away β it stays βGrade Pendingβ until a re-inspection settles it, which is why some spots here show an hourglass instead of a letter.
